I think that you tune an AFR and then have values in the SMART fuel table so that the load cells try to stay in the 0 cells, but if they stray up or down (AFR thus changing) then the cells which surround the path of 0's have either - or + fuel offsets to get you back towards the path of 0's. The further you begin to stray then the harsher the offsets to put the load cells back on path. At least this is how it appears to me when I look at the SMART fuel map.

I understand all this but the actual AFR sceme doesn't seem to correspond to the innovative software.
The thing to remember is that the Xede's AFR values have to be rescaled before they can be compared to the data from the LC-1 itself.
The problem is that shiv says the AFR Load of the SMART fuel map doesnt mean anything.
I do not see how this can be so. the Load variable of the smart fuel map IS the AFR (in 0-100%). The same AFR that is coming out of the LC-1 is being fed into the Xede Smart fuel map, and the fuel is being modified because of it. I do not see any other way this could work, unless there are underlying things in the Xede that we cannot see happening.
It should be as simple as creating a 'zero line' through the smart fuel map at the AFR ranges you want. however, shiv said not to touch this smart fuel map. so i do not know what to do....
